How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Aloha?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Aloha Studio Apartments | $1,620 | $640 | $2,118 |
| Aloha 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,770 | $1,072 | $4,698 |
| Aloha 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,011 | $1,178 | $5,864 |
| Aloha 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,554 | $1,544 | $4,100 |
| Aloha 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,357 | $2,145 | $3,950 |
How much does it cost to rent a home in Aloha?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2 Bedroom Homes | $2,034 | $1,335 | $4,850 |
| 3 Bedroom Homes | $2,678 | $2,095 | $5,500 |
| 4 Bedroom Homes | $3,321 | $1,500 | $8,550 |
| 5 Bedroom Homes | $3,832 | $2,925 | $4,999 |
